如何在Ubuntu和Linux Mint中创建或者添加交换分区

时间:2020-02-23 14:38:24  来源:igfitidea点击:

交换分区是获得最佳性能和稳定性的重要特征,尤其是具有较小内存的PC。
简而言之,交换空间就像添加内存,但不是物理的空间,而是像虚拟内存这样的内存分配某些量的硬盘空间!

步骤1:第一步是检查是否有机会在PC中创建了任何交换分区。
使用see' swapon'命令: sudo swapon --show输入root密码。
如果不看到输出,则表示交换不存在。

步骤2:接下来,让我们看看计算机硬盘的当前分区结构。
使用'df'命令: df -h我们应该看到像我在测试PC中获得的分区结构。

终端显示当前分区

第3步:现在是时候创建交换文件了。
确保我们有足够的硬盘空间。
它是对我们需要的交换大小的偏好。

通常,对于换档尺寸的内存具有两倍的良好。
但是你甚至可以尽可能多地继续你的选择。

在这个例子中,我选择使用内存的两倍。
我有2 GB内存的测试PC。
所以,我将把4 GB设置为交换。
运行以下命令。
使用号码而不是4:

sudo fallocate -l 4G /swapfile

步骤4:创建交换文件。
让我们为它提供root-off。 sudo chmod 600 /swapfile

步骤5:将文件标记为交换空间: sudo mkswap /swapfile

步骤6:最终启用交换。 sudo swapon /swapfile

步骤7:我们现在可以使用相同的swapon命令检查是否已创建交换。 sudo swapon --show

步骤8:还重新检查最终分区结构。 free -h

步骤9:设置一切都已设置后,必须将交换文件设置为永久性,否则我们将在重新启动后丢失交换。
运行此命令: echo '/swapfile none swap sw 0 0' | sudo tee -a /etc/fstab

退出终端。

我们可以启动"系统监视器"实用程序并检查交换状态。
它应该启用!